- [ ] Step 7: Archive cold storage buckets (Glacierline tier). Confirm both ceremony witnesses are present, verify bucket manifests match the Oxbow ledger, then seal the archive key shares. Plugin authors may observe but not handle shares. Once sealed, the archive index itself is encrypted and can only be reopened with the passphrase below.

vault phrase of badup-hahig = tamael-aldael-kelmir-istael-fenok-istwyn-tamius-jorath-oliion

## Deploying the Gatewick Proctor Queue

Deploys are pretty painless: push to main, wait for the pipeline, then watch the queue drain dashboard for five minutes. If candidates pile up mid-exam, roll back first and ask questions later — the queue replays safely. Everything the workers care about lives in one config block, shown here for reference.

settings of bafof-yagef:
JOROX_PIN=8740
JOROX_TENANT=pelox
JOROX_METRICS_HOST=metrics.jorox.qorvelworks.internal
JOROX_SEAL=seal_c78f63c1
JOROX_STANDBY_TEAM=norax

# Env file — Cartwheel dispatch, driver-assignment heuristic
# Scope: staging only. Do not promote to prod.
# The heuristic weights (proximity, shift balance, refusal rate) are tuned
# for the Velmont pilot region and will misbehave elsewhere.
# Review notes: heuristic service runs unprivileged; it reads weights
# read-only from the tuning store and writes nothing back.
# Only one sensitive value exists in this file: the tuning-store access
# credential, consumed at boot and never logged.
# That credential is set on the following line.

secret setting of faduf-bahop: LEDGER_TOKEN8=c3b363be

Break-glass access for the Emberline rendering stack: if template render latency exceeds the page budget and normal deploys are frozen, on-call may bypass review to hot-patch the partial cache. New team members should read the incident log first. To activate the bypass console, enter the recovery passphrase below.

vault phrase of tajef-tafog = istox-sorax-zorox-casok-holox-kelix-weneth-drueth-casion